30、从Excel发送Outlook邮件:自动化办公的利器

从Excel发送Outlook邮件:自动化办公的利器

1. 引言

在现代办公环境中,自动化处理日常任务可以显著提高工作效率。其中一个常见的需求是从Excel中自动化发送Outlook邮件。通过Excel VBA(Visual Basic for Applications),我们可以轻松实现这一目标。本文将详细介绍如何使用VBA代码从Excel中发送Outlook邮件,涵盖从创建Outlook对象到发送邮件的具体步骤。

2. 创建Outlook对象

在开始编写代码之前,我们需要确保已经安装了Microsoft Outlook,并且它与Excel在同一台计算机上运行。接下来,我们将介绍如何创建Outlook对象。

2.1 声明变量

首先,我们需要声明一些变量来存储Outlook应用程序对象和邮件对象。以下是具体的代码:

声明 OutlookApp 为对象
声明 Email 为对象
声明 Subject 为字符串
声明 EmailAddress 为字符串
声明 Msg 为字符串

2.2 初始化Outlook对象

接下来,我们需要创建一个Outlook应用程序对象。这可以通过 CreateObject 函数来实现:

' 创建 Outlook 对象
Set OutlookApp = CreateObject("Outlook.Application")

3. 设置

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值